RE at Brigstock

Believe ~ Grow ~ Flourish  

“Jesus came to give us life, life in all its fullness” 

 

 At Brigstock Primary, we believe that it is important for all our pupils to learn from and about religion, so that they can understand the world around them. The aim of Religious Education in our school is to help children to acquire and develop knowledge and understanding of Christianity and the other principal religions represented in Great Britain and the wider world; to appreciate the way that religious beliefs shape life and behaviour, develop the ability to make reasoned and informed judgements about religious and moral issues and enhance their spiritual, moral, social and cultural development. Religious Education is taught throughout the school in such a way as to reflect the overall aims, values, and philosophy of the school. 

 

The teaching and implementation of the Religious Education Curriculum at Brigstock Primary School is taught following the Peterborough Agreed Syllabus for Religious Education alongside the Understanding Christianity units of work. Sequences of lessons are carefully planned using progression mapping within and across key stage phases. Key questions act as the driver for growth within each unit and inspire active learning and challenge for all. Opportunities for cross-curricular learning are identified and explored through our wider curriculum.  

 

The children at Brigstock Primary enjoy learning about and from other religions. Through their RE learning the children are able to make links between their own lives and those of others in their community and in the wider world. As such, RE is essential in enabling the children at Brigstock to understand beliefs and be enabled to grow and flourish into citizens of an ever changing world.
